3 concrete AI opportunities with ROI framing
1. Dynamic pricing for revenue maximization. AI algorithms can analyze competitor rates, local event calendars, weather, and historical booking curves to adjust room prices in real time. For a portfolio of hotels, a 5-10% RevPAR lift translates directly to hundreds of thousands in new annual revenue. This is often the fastest AI win, with cloud-based tools integrating into existing PMS platforms.
2. AI-powered workforce management. Labor is the largest variable cost in hospitality. AI can forecast occupancy down to the hour and auto-generate optimal schedules for housekeeping, front desk, and maintenance. Reducing overstaffing by even 3% across a 300-employee workforce saves significant payroll dollars while avoiding understaffing that hurts guest scores.
3. Personalized guest engagement. An AI-driven guest messaging platform can handle pre-arrival upsells, answer FAQs, and resolve issues via text or chat. This shifts bookings away from OTAs to direct channels (saving 15-25% commission) and increases ancillary spend. When guests feel known and valued, they return—and leave better reviews.
Deployment risks specific to this size band
Mid-market operators face unique AI adoption risks. First, data fragmentation across legacy PMS, POS, and CRM systems can stall projects. A data audit and API-first vendor selection are critical. Second, change management is tough: front-line staff may fear automation. Transparent communication that AI is an assistant, not a replacement, is essential. Third, vendor lock-in with niche hospitality AI startups can be risky; prioritize platforms with open integrations and proven scalability. Finally, cybersecurity must be addressed—guest data is sensitive, and mid-market firms often underinvest in IT security. Start with a single-property pilot, measure results rigorously, and scale what works.
